Description

The technical specifications and advances/ upgrades of the stationary (EOLE) and mobile (AIAS) lidars located at the National Technical University of Athens (NTUA) are presented in this paper. EOLE is a multi-wavelength combined backscatter/Raman lidar system, which is part of the EARLINET lidar network since May 2000. AIAS is a mobile 532 nm elastic depolarization lidar system. Both instruments have been upgraded during 2019, in the frame of PANACEA to be part of the Greek National Research Infrastructure for aerosol research, under the umbrella of the European Strategy Forum on Research Infrastructures (ESFRI).
